Arizona Coyotes center Nick Schmaltz was placed on the injured-reserve list with a week-to-week lower-body injury, the team announced Thursday.
This announcement came shortly after the Coyotes recalled center Laurent Dauphin from the Tucson Roadrunners.
Schmaltz was acquired by the Coyotes in late November from the Chicago Blackhawks for Dylan Strome and Brendan Perlini. In 17 games since the trade, Schamltz 14 points for Arizona.
It’s another piece of bad luck for the injury-plagued Coyotes.
Head coach Rick Tocchet spoke about the issues caused by players missing so much time with 98.7 FM Arizona’s Sports Station on Wednesday.
“It’s hard to find continuity [because of the injuries],” he said. “It’s almost like every game, you come in and you’re told you’re not going to have this guy and it’s tough.”
Coming into the season, the Coyotes were a popular pick to be a playoff sleeper, but they haven’t been able to live up to those expectations with their record at 17-21-2.
